How secure is europe's energy sector and how it interacts with water and food security. Sandu, S. & Yang, M. In Heading Towards Sustainable Energy Systems: Evolution or Revolution?, 15th IAEE European Conference, Sept 3-6, 2017, 2017. International Association for Energy Economics.

This paper develops composite indices for assessing the state of energy security of 17 European countries between 2000 and 2010, and examines the nature of interactions that energy security has on water and food securities. It demonstrates that a simple tool such as a composite security index is an important first-step to develop an in-depth and a comprehensive understanding of energy security in order to deal with this challenge. The results in this paper provide insights into the state of energy security across the select European countries, the factors that contribute to insecurity, and the effect that energy security may have on water and food security. These results can be used to enable monitoring of countries‟ security performance over time, convey policy messages that can help policymakers to prioritise security concerns that are specific to their countries, and to support political dialogue aiming to improve energy-water-food security.
